About Artist, Author & Poet Kristina Jacobs
Kristina Jacobs is a dabbler. She writes a dab of this and a bit of that. She also plays with many different art mediums, including clay, wood carving, chip carving, paint pouring, fabric art, resin, cake, photography & more!
She enjoys writing poetry and children’s fantasy. She has published two children’s books: Orion and the Land of the Tomatoes and Sambala the Mighty and Mimba the Wanderer. Her other published works include three short story collections: The Adventures of Sample Girl, Tales of the Wyrd and EverHollow: Stories from the Otherlands. She even penned one short “you solve it” murder mystery called The Salted Caper.
Jacobs is the author of eighteen poetry chapbooks: The Wildwood Guardian, Grey Weir, Slipshod Mornings & Meandering Midnights, Inside Invisible, Dawn After Dusk, Dept. 56, Sparks, Drawn by Grace, All the Purple Days, Charm All Over the Place, Chasing Ordinary, True North, The Heart of the Otherlands, Just my Luck, Breaking Radio Silence, Crook-Tailed Tales (with co-author, Gary Alexander Azerier), Lucky 13 and Signs Point Left.
Even though she can’t sing, she once wrote a lyric songbook called Musicians Wanted to match her lyrics with musical people who can’t write the words to go with their songs!
With the Indie Collaboration she’s contributed to several anthologies including: Yuletide Tales, Kiss and Tales, Snips, Snails & Puppy Dog Tales, Summer Shorts
and Kiss and Tales 2.
In 2022, she published her first full length novel, a science fiction fantasy called Gateways Through the Penumbra.
Kristina is also a member of the poetry group, Emerging Poets and is currently serving as guest editor for their anthology, No Day But Today! which was released, October 2021, The Next Level Publishing.
